Emotions

In homosexual dreams, the individual’s emotions play a crucial role in understanding the dream’s meaning. These emotions may include fear, confusion, guilt, desire, and even love.

It is vital to pay attention to the specific emotions being felt in the dream as they can give insight into the individual’s unconscious thoughts and feelings. For example, if the dreamer feels fear or confusion about their sexual identity, it may signify internal conflict and uncertainty about their true desires.

On the other hand, if the dreamer experiences desire or love in the dream, it may represent a longing for a same-sex relationship or a desire to explore their sexuality further.

Additionally, guilt is a common emotion in homosexual dreams, especially for individuals who come from religious or conservative backgrounds. This guilt may be a reflection of the societal pressure and stigma that surrounds same-sex relationships.

Understanding and acknowledging these emotions can aid in interpreting the dream’s meaning and help the individual better understand their own thoughts and feelings towards their sexuality.

Step-by-Step Guide

When interpreting your homosexual dreams, it can be helpful to follow a step-by-step guide. This can clarify the symbols and emotions present in your dream, and help you better understand its meaning.

Step 1: Write down the details of your dream, including any emotions you experienced during it. Take note of any people, places, or objects that stood out.

Step 2: Consider the context of the dream. Were you in a familiar or unfamiliar environment? Were you alone or with others? Was the dream realistic or fantastical?

Step 3: Look for common homosexual dream themes, such as being attracted to someone of the same gender or engaging in same-sex sexual activity. Compare your dream to these common themes and consider any similarities or differences.

Step 4: Explore your personal emotions and experiences related to homosexuality. Have you recently had an important conversation about your sexuality or been struggling with your sexual identity? Has a past relationship or experience influenced your feelings towards homosexuality?

Coming Out

Coming out is a common theme in homosexual dreams. Coming out in a dream can represent a desire to be open and honest about one’s sexuality. It can also represent anxiety about how others will react to one’s homosexuality. Some people may struggle with their sexuality and feel like they cannot be themselves around family or friends, which can cause stress and anxiety. However, coming out in a dream can also be a positive symbol, representing acceptance and self-discovery.

If you have a dream about coming out, it is important to consider the context of the dream. Did you feel happy or scared when you told someone? Were they accepting or judgmental? These details can provide insights into your subconscious thoughts and feelings about your sexuality.

Sometimes, coming out dreams may be triggered by real-life events, such as when an individual has recently come out to others. In other cases, the dream may be a reflection of a person’s desire to come out and live their authentic life.

It is essential to acknowledge and honor your feelings and emotions around coming out, whether in a dream or in real life. It takes courage and strength to share one’s sexuality with others, and it’s important to remember that you deserve love and support, no matter what your sexual orientation is.

Cultural and Religious Background

Our cultural and religious background can have a significant impact on how we view homosexual dreams and interpret their meaning. For some individuals, same-sex attraction is seen as taboo or sinful due to their cultural or religious beliefs. This can lead to feelings of guilt or shame when having a homosexual dream.

Here are some factors to consider when interpreting homosexual dreams in relation to cultural and religious background:

  • Upbringing: Those raised in conservative or religious households may have internalized beliefs about homosexuality being morally wrong. This can affect how they interpret their dreams and their emotional reactions to them.
  • Community: Living in a community that is not accepting of LGBTQ+ individuals can lead to anxiety or fear about one’s own sexuality and dreams. It is important to remember that everyone’s experiences and beliefs are different and that seeking support may be beneficial.
  • Religious Beliefs: Some religions may view same-sex attraction as a sin or immoral. This can lead to feelings of guilt or shame, which may manifest in dreams. It is important to seek guidance from a trusted spiritual advisor or counselor who can help you navigate conflicting feelings and interpretations.
  • Cultural Norms: Cultural norms around sexuality vary and can greatly impact an individual’s perception of their dreams. Some cultures may be more accepting of same-sex attraction and relationships while others may view them as taboo or shameful.

Personal Experiences

Our personal life experiences can heavily influence the interpretation of our dreams, including homosexual dreams. It is important to take into account any past experiences that may have shaped our subconscious thoughts and perceptions towards homosexual themes. These experiences might manifest themselves in various ways in our dreams, and can often be an indication of unresolved issues or emotional distress.

Examples of personal experiences that can impact homosexual dreams include:

Childhood experiences – Memories of childhood friendships or being exposed to homosexuality at an early age can influence our thoughts and dreams later in life. For example, if you had a close friend who was gay as a child, it could potentially shape the way you perceive and interpret homosexual dreams in the future.
Personal sexuality – Our own sexual orientation can shape the way we dream about homosexuality. If you are comfortable with your own sexual identity, you may be more open to exploring same-sex themes in your dreams. On the other hand, if you struggle with accepting your own sexuality, homosexual dreams may evoke feelings of shame or guilt.
Cultural background – Cultural norms and beliefs surrounding homosexuality can significantly impact the way we interpret homosexual dreams. In cultures where homosexuality is not accepted, a person might interpret a homosexual dream as an immoral act, while someone from a more liberal culture might view the dream more positively.
Past relationships – Our past relationships, both romantic and platonic, can play a role in the kinds of dreams we have. If you have had same-sex relationships in the past, it can influence the content of your dreams about homosexuality. Likewise, if you have had negative experiences with someone of the same gender, it could impact how you interpret these dreams.

It is important to be mindful of these personal experiences in order to gain a deeper understanding of the potential meanings behind our homosexual dreams. By recognizing and acknowledging these experiences, we can more effectively work through any unresolved emotional issues that may be surfacing in our dreams.

Journaling and Reflection

One effective way to cope with homosexual dreams is through journaling and reflection. This involves keeping a journal where you can write down your thoughts, feelings, and experiences related to your dreams. By taking the time to reflect on your dreams, you may be able to gain a better understanding of your subconscious desires and feelings.

Through journaling, you can also track patterns that may arise in your dreams. For example, you may notice that you have recurring dreams about a certain person or situation. This can allow you to delve deeper into what these dreams may be trying to tell you.

Reflection can also involve seeking out a therapist or counselor who is knowledgeable about LGBTQ issues. They can provide a supportive and safe space where you can openly discuss your dreams and any related concerns.

In addition to journaling and seeking support, self-care is also important when dealing with challenging emotions and experiences. This can involve engaging in soothing activities such as meditation, exercise, or spending time in nature.

It is important to remember that homosexual dreams are a natural part of human experience. Through self-reflection and seeking support, you can learn to better understand and cope with these dreams in a healthy and productive way.
